Grandtheft teams up with Jazz Cartier on “B.I.G.”

Producer Grandtheft shared his latest single, "B.I.G." alongside Toronto-based rapper Jazz Cartier, on Friday. On the heels of signing to A-Trak's Brooklyn-based label Fool's Gold, the producer shared the anthemic track full of blaring horns, crisp hi-hats, and a booming bassline underpinning Cartier's braggadocious delivery. “'B.I.G.' is about intention—it’s about dreaming big, stating your goals out loud, and taking risks to get you where you’re going,” says Grandtheft in a statement about the track. “These massive soul stabs and the anthemic chorus should motivate you to break through any walls standing in the path to attaining what you strive for most in life.”On the track, Cartier positions himself as one of Toronto's best, naming.
